• Allan

    I have no idea what they are singing, but MAN thats a catchy song.

  • When I first came to Japan the song everyone had to learn was NAGISA NI MATSUWARU ET CETERA by Puffy. It is a really catchy song and got us a lot of fans at the local karaoke bars :)

    • Donald Ash

      I haven’t heard that one yet, but I need to! Thanks for posting! :D

Back to top
mobile desktop